Florida Quality Sponsoring Workgroup: Renewal Decision-making

July 10th through July 12th , 2007

The Workgroup started at 10 with introductions and a brief tribute to Dr. Carlo R. Rodriguez.   The groups also was able to vocalize concerns to the Florida Department of Education representative present, Jean Miller.   The attendees split up into two groups of five to discuss what was presented from NASCA the compiled and edited work of what the group worked on last month on the renewal process along with what a possible Timing consideration for us to review and work on.   Our mission was to review the compiled and edited changes to see if they worked and if they aligned with State Statutes. The categories remained #1 Educational/Academic Performance, #2 Organizational Performance, and #3 Financial Performance.  

At noon, we had a working lunch to review and discuss timing considerations for the reviewing process and when to notify the school of non renewal (90 days is required in statutes).   We, as a group, created a Best Practice Timeline for the renewal process which consisted of the following draft:

June 30th: Notification to school that renewal process will begin and they are up for renewal at the end of the school year

            September: Packet to School

            December: Packet Complete

            October - January: Site Visits

            February - March: Review with all parties

            February - March: School & District Meeting

            March 30 th: 90 day notice of renewal or non renewal
